About CRG

CRG specialises in the analysis of communications (both content and impact) using a variety of methodologies from psychological, social and market research. These range from the design of problem solving experiments and of bench mark public opinion surveys through to the exploratory probing of issues using in-depth interviews and focus groups.

Perhaps CRG is particularly well known for its content analysis work which has been used extensively to examine patterns, both quantitatively and qualitatively, in television programming and advertising. As a methodology content analysis has been used to look at:

  • Smoking and health-related behaviours on television
  • Sex, nudity, violence and bad language on television
  • Media portrayal of people from minority groups in television, radio and advertisements
  • Quality, breadth and depth of news coverage on television and radio
  •  Portrayal of women and gender on television and radio
  •  Crime news reporting on television and radio
  •  Prominence and representation of commercial products on terrestrial and digital television
  •  Representation of sponsorship in sports programmes across terrestrial channels
  •  Media portrayal of The Miner's Strike
  •  Media portrayal of The Gulf War

CRG regularly provides expert witness evidence in legal prosecutions - a number of which have been test cases involving books, music and video games. 

CRG Technology hosts a wide range of audio and video recording and copying facilities to and from any format with optional analogue or digital enhancement to clean recordings. Equipment includes 24 track Ampex logging recorders.
